WCBS Faces Critical O-Negative Blood Shortages

Urgent Appeal for O-Negative, O-Positive and B-Positive Donors to Donate Blood. CAPE TOWN, 9 December 2025 — The Western Cape Blood Service (WCBS) is appealing to all O-negative, O-positive and B-positive blood donors to donate as soon as possible, as blood stocks have reached critical levels.
